    The Epidemiology of Multimorbidity in Primary Care

    Get PDF
    Background: Multimorbidity places a substantial burden on patients and the healthcare system but few contemporary data are available. Aim: To describe the epidemiology of multimorbidity in adults in England and quantify associations between multimorbidity and health service utilisation. Design: Retrospective cohort study Setting: A random sample of 403,985 adult patients (≥18 years) in England who were registered with a general practice on 1 January 2012 and included in the Clinical Practice Research Datalink. Methods: We defined multimorbidity as having two or more of 36 long-term conditions recorded in patients’ medical records and quantified associations between multimorbidity and health service utilisation (GP consultations, prescriptions, and hospitalisations) over four years. Results: 27.2% of patients were multimorbid. The most prevalent conditions were hypertension (18.2%), depression or anxiety (10.3%), and chronic pain (10.1%). Prevalence of multimorbidity was higher in females than males (30% vs. 24.4% respectively) and among those with lower socioeconomic status (33.8% in the most deprived quintile vs. 24.2% in the least deprived quintile). Physical-mental comorbidity contributed a much greater proportion of overall morbidity in both younger patients and those patients with lower socioeconomic status. Multimorbidity was strongly associated with health service utilisation. Multimorbid patients accounted for 53% of GP consultations, 79% of prescriptions, and 56% percent of hospital admissions. Conclusion: Multimorbidity is common, socially patterned, and associated with increased health service utilisation.     Improving the diagnostic process for patients with possible bladder and kidney cancer: a mixed-methods study to identify potential missed diagnostic opportunities

    BACKGROUND: Patients with bladder and kidney cancer may experience diagnostic delays. AIM: To identify patterns of suboptimal care and contributors of potential missed diagnostic opportunities (MDOs). DESIGN AND SETTING: Prospective, mixed-methods study recruiting participants from nine general practices in Eastern England between June 2018 and October 2019. METHOD: Patients with possible bladder and kidney cancer were identified using eligibility criteria based on National Institute for Health and Care Excellence (NICE) guidelines for suspected cancer. Primary care records were reviewed at recruitment and at 1 year for data on symptoms, tests, referrals, and diagnosis. Referral predictors were examined using logistic regression. Semi-structured interviews were undertaken with 15 patients to explore their experiences of the diagnostic process, and these were analysed thematically. RESULTS: Participants (n = 940) were mostly female (n = 657, 69.9%), with a median age of 71 years (interquartile range 64-77 years). In total, 268 (28.5%) received a referral and 465 (48.5%) had a final diagnosis of urinary tract infection (UTI). There were 33 (3.5%) patients who were diagnosed with cancer, including prostate (n = 17), bladder (n = 7), and upper urothelial tract (n = 1) cancers. Among referred patients, those who had a final diagnosis of UTI had the longest time to referral (median 81.5 days). Only one-third of patients with recurrent UTIs were referred despite meeting NICE referral guidelines. Qualitative findings revealed barriers during the diagnostic process, including inadequate clinical examination, female patients given repeated antibiotics without clinical reviews, and suboptimal communication of test results to patients. CONCLUSION: Older females with UTIs might be at increased risk of MDOs for cancer. Targeting barriers during the initial diagnostic assessment and follow-up might improve quality of diagnosis

    Medically explained symptoms: a mixed methods study of diagnostic, symptom and support experiences of patients with lupus and related systemic autoimmune diseases.

    OBJECTIVES: The aim was to explore patient experiences and views of their symptoms, delays in diagnosis, misdiagnoses and medical support, to identify common experiences, preferences and unmet needs. METHODS: Following a review of LUPUS UK's online forum, a questionnaire was posted online during December 2018. This was an exploratory mixed methods study, with qualitative data analysed thematically and combined with descriptive and statistically analysed quantitative data. RESULTS: There were 233 eligible respondents. The mean time to diagnosis from first experiencing symptoms was 6 years 11 months. Seventy-six per cent reported at least one misdiagnosis for symptoms subsequently attributed to their systemic autoimmune rheumatic disease. Mental health/non-organic misdiagnoses constituted 47% of reported misdiagnoses and were indicated to have reduced trust in physicians and to have changed future health-care-seeking behaviour. Perceptions of physician knowledge and listening skills were highly correlated with patient ratings of trust. The symptom burden was high. Fatigue had the greatest impact on activities of daily living, yet the majority reported receiving no support or poor support in managing it. Assessing and treating patients holistically and with empathy was strongly felt to increase diagnostic accuracy and improve medical relationships. CONCLUSION: Patient responses indicated that timely diagnosis could be facilitated if physicians had greater knowledge of lupus/related systemic autoimmune diseases and were more amenable to listening to and believing patient reports of their symptoms.     Study protocol for iQuit in Practice: a randomised controlled trial to assess the feasibility, acceptability and effectiveness of tailored web- and text-based facilitation of smoking cessation in primary care.

    BACKGROUND: Primary care is an important setting for smoking cessation interventions. There is evidence for the effectiveness of tailored interventions for smoking cessation, and text messaging interventions for smoking cessation show promise. The intervention to be evaluated in this trial consists of two components: (1) a web-based program designed to be used by a practice nurse or other smoking cessation advisor (SCA); the program generates a cessation advice report that is highly tailored to relevant characteristics of the smoker; and (2) a three-month programme of automated tailored text messages sent to the smoker's mobile phone. The objectives of the trial are to assess the acceptability and feasibility of the intervention and to estimate the short-term effectiveness of the intervention in increasing the quit rate compared with usual care alone. METHODS/DESIGN: The design is a two parallel group randomised controlled trial (RCT). 600 smokers who want to quit will be recruited in up to 30 general practices in the East of England. During a consultation with an SCA, they will be individually randomised by computer program to usual care (Control) or to usual care plus the iQuit system (Intervention). At the four-week follow-up appointment, the SCA will record smoking status and measure carbon monoxide level. There will be two further follow-ups, at eight weeks and six months from randomisation date, by postal questionnaire sent from and returned to the study centre or by telephone interview conducted by a research interviewer. The primary outcome will be self-reported abstinence for at least two weeks at eight weeks. A sample size of 300 per group would give 80% power to detect an increase in quit rate from 20% to 30% (alpha = 0.05, 2-sided test). The main analyses of quit rates will be conducted on an intention-to-treat basis, making the usual assumption that participants lost to follow up are smoking. DISCUSSION: This trial will focus on acceptability, feasibility and short-term effectiveness. The findings will be used to refine the intervention and to inform the decision to proceed to a pragmatic trial to estimate longer-term effectiveness and cost-effectiveness.     Randomized controlled trial to assess the short-term effectiveness of tailored web- and text-based facilitation of smoking cessation in primary care (iQuit in practice).

    AIMS: To estimate the short-term effectiveness, feasibility and acceptability of a smoking cessation intervention (the iQuit system) that consists of tailored printed and Short Message Service (SMS) text message self-help delivered as an adjunct to cessation support in primary care to inform the design of a definitive trial. DESIGN: A stratified two parallel-group randomized controlled trial comparing usual care (control) with usual care plus the iQuit system (intervention), delivered by primary care nurses/healthcare assistants who were blinded to the allocation sequence. SETTING: Thirty-two general practice (GP) surgeries in England, UK. PARTICIPANTS: A total of 602 smokers initiating smoking cessation support from their local GP surgery were randomized (control n = 303, intervention n = 299). MEASUREMENTS: Primary outcome was self-reported 2-week point prevalence abstinence at 8 weeks follow-up. Secondary smoking outcomes and feasibility and acceptability measures were collected at 4 weeks after quit date, 8 weeks and 6 months follow-up. FINDINGS: There were no significant between-group differences in the primary outcome [control 40.3%, iQuit 45.2%; odds ratio (OR) = 1.22, 95% confidence interval (CI) = 0.88-1.69] or in secondary short-term smoking outcomes. Six-month prolonged abstinence was significantly higher in the iQuit arm (control 8.9%, iQuit 15.1%; OR = 1.81, 95% CI = 1.09-3.01). iQuit support took on average 7.7 minutes (standard deviation = 4.0) to deliver and 18.9% (95% CI = 14.8-23.7%) of intervention participants discontinued the text message support during the programme. CONCLUSIONS: Tailored printed and text message self-help delivered alongside routine smoking cessation support in primary care does not significantly increase short-term abstinence, but may increase long-term abstinence and demonstrated feasibility and acceptability compared with routine cessation support alone

    Assessment of the Effectiveness and Cost-Effectiveness of Tailored Web- and Text-Based Smoking Cessation Support in Primary Care (iQuit in Practice II): Protocol for a Randomized Controlled Trial.

    BACKGROUND: The prevalence of smoking is declining; however, it continues to be a major public health burden. In England, primary care is the health setting that provides smoking cessation support to most smokers. However, this setting has one of the lowest success rates. The iQuit in practice intervention (iQuit) is a tailored web-based and text message intervention developed for use in primary care consultations as an adjunct to routine smoking cessation support with the aim of increasing success rates. iQuit has demonstrated feasibility, acceptability, and potential effectiveness. OBJECTIVE: This definitive trial aims to determine the effectiveness and cost-effectiveness of iQuit when used as an adjunct to the usual support provided to patients who wish to quit smoking, compared with usual care alone. METHODS: The iQuit in Practice II trial is a two-arm, parallel-group, randomized controlled trial (RCT) with a 1:1 individual allocation comparing usual care (ie, pharmacotherapy combined with multisession behavioral support)-the control-with usual care plus iQuit-the intervention. Participants were recruited through primary care clinics and talked to a smoking cessation advisor. Participants were randomized during the initial consultation, and those allocated to the intervention group received a tailored advice report and 90 days of text messaging in addition to the standard support provided to all patients. RESULTS: The primary outcome is self-reported prolonged abstinence biochemically verified using saliva cotinine at 6 months after the quit date. A sample size of 1700 participants, with 850 per arm, would yield 90% power to detect a 4.3% difference in validated quit rates between the groups at the two-sided 5% level of significance. The Cambridge East Research Ethics Committee approved the study in February 2016, and funding for the study was granted from May 2016. In total, 1671 participants were recruited between August 2016 and July 2019. Follow-up for all participants was completed in January 2020. Data analysis will begin in the summer of 2020. CONCLUSIONS: iQuit in Practice II is a definitive, pragmatic RCT assessing whether a digital intervention can augment the impact of routine smoking cessation support in primary care. Previous research has found good acceptability and feasibility for delivering iQuit among smoking cessation advisors working in primary care. If demonstrated to be cost-effective, iQuit could be delivered across primary care and other settings, such as community pharmacies. The potential benefit would likely be highest where less behavioral support is delivered.
